http://flashugnews.com/does-vitamin-water-have-electrolytes-everything-you-need-to-know/ WebApr 9, 2024 · Eyesight : Retinol is responsible for making the pigments in the eye's retina and it promotes good night vision. When there are inadequate amounts of it in the body, vision can become impaired. Night blindness and total blindness can develop. 1 . Healthy growth and development : Retinol plays a vital role in cell growth and differentiation.
WebSep 6, 2024 · Vitamin A (VitA) is a micronutrient that is crucial for maintaining vision, promoting growth and development, and protecting epithelium and mucus integrity in the body. VitA is known as an anti-inflammation vitamin because of its critical role in enhancing immune function.

Vitamin A is involved in the creation of certain cells, including B cells and T cells, which play central roles in immune responses that guard against disease.
